Evaluating Students' Requirements in Chemistry Instruction
How can instructors effectively evaluate the unique requirements of each chemistry pupil? A comprehensive analysis approach is vital for identifying individual abilities and shortcomings. Initially, mentors may use diagnostic assessments, which measure a student's present knowledge and skill level in chemistry. This can include quizzes or informal interviews to assess a student's background and specific problematic topics.
Moreover, observing student participation during sessions can yield insights into their learning preferences and emotional responses. Comments from students about their experiences can further clarify their needs. Tutors should also take into consideration the educational goals of students, whether they are preparing for copyrights, improving grades, or building more profound knowledge of chemistry concepts.

Kinesthetic Instructional Techniques
For kinesthetic learners, hands-on experiences and physical activities are vital in grasping complex notions in chemistry. Expert chemistry tutors can boost learning by incorporating interactive experiments and tactile materials. Utilizing models, such as molecular kits, enables students to visualize structures and reactions physically. Additionally, involving students in lab activities fosters a heightened understanding of scientific principles through real-world applications. Tutors may also employ role-playing scenarios, where students dramatize chemical processes, reinforcing knowledge through movement. Furthermore, integrating technology, such as virtual labs, offers immersive experiences for those unable to conduct experiments in person. By tailoring strategies to meet kinesthetic preferences, tutors can significantly improve student engagement and grasp in chemistry.

What Is the Average Price of Chemistry Tutoring Classes?
Generally, chemistry tutoring classes cost between $30 to $100 per hour, influenced by factors such as the tutor's background, geographical area, and session length. Prices may fluctuate widely depending on individual circumstances and particular requirements.
